Mistake #1: Procedure Pages With Too Little Decision-Useful Clinical Context

Observable evidence: Review a procedure page as a prospective patient would. If it contains mostly promotional copy, omits who the page is for, does not explain the consultation or recovery questions the practice is prepared to address, and lacks visible clinical review where needed, the defect is content depth and governance rather than simple word count. The healthcare SEO compliance context is relevant when claims, patient information, or regulated advertising are involved.

Consequence: A thin page may give search systems and prospective patients too little distinct information to understand why the page is useful. It can also increase the risk that marketing language outruns the evidence or the surgeon's actual practice.

Correction: Build the page around accurate decision questions: what the procedure generally involves, who may need an individualized consultation, what recovery topics should be discussed, material risks that require appropriate clinical framing, and verifiable surgeon qualifications or training. Do not add medical claims merely to make the page longer.

The source previously stated that procedure pages under 800 words rarely ranked beyond branded queries. No supporting source URL or methodology is present in this JSON, so preserve that figure only as an internal historical observation, not as a minimum-length rule. The verification question is whether the revised page is more complete, accurate, and useful, not whether it crosses a word-count threshold.

Owner: Content lead with the surgeon or designated clinical reviewer for medical accuracy and advertising-sensitive statements.

Verification: Compare the revised page with the original content inventory, confirm that material claims have appropriate review, inspect Search Console query coverage after recrawling, and record whether qualified consultation paths improve without attributing causality prematurely. This content cannot guarantee compliance; responsible legal, medical, or regulatory reviewers remain required for practice-specific claims and publishing decisions.

Mistake #2: Treating Google Business Profile as a Static Listing

Observable evidence: Compare the live Google Business Profile with the practice's source-of-truth business record. Look for incorrect categories, missing or inaccurate procedure information, obsolete hours, weak photo representation, unanswered public questions, or conflicting name, address, phone, and website details.

Consequence: Inaccurate profile information can make local discovery less useful and can send prospective patients to the wrong contact details or expectations. The source described the local result block as an important inquiry surface, but it does not provide a supporting source URL or a verified click-share statistic here.

Correction: Use the most accurate available category, keep services and business facts current, add representative practice imagery when appropriate, and answer public questions carefully without disclosing patient information. Posting cadence and profile activity should be treated as operating practices, not as documented guarantees of ranking improvement.

For review governance, use the plastic surgeon SEO audit guidance to inspect what is actually happening. Ask eligible patients consistently for honest feedback without incentives, discouraging negative feedback, selecting only satisfied patients, or scripting treatment-specific language. Do not treat review velocity or response frequency as an official ranking factor.

Owner: Practice manager or local-search owner, with privacy and regulatory review for patient images, testimonials, and responses where required.

Verification: Recheck the live profile against the clinic record, confirm that links and contact actions work, sample recent public questions and reviews for policy compliance, and measure local discovery actions separately from organic blue-link rankings.

Mistake #3: Mapping Too Much of the Search Journey to Too Few Pages

Observable evidence: Export the queries and landing pages that already receive impressions. If the homepage is expected to answer broad practice searches, procedure comparisons, recovery questions, cost research, surgeon-evaluation queries, and follow-up concerns at once, the information architecture is too compressed.

Consequence: A single generic page may not match the specific decision a prospective patient is making. This can leave relevant procedure questions unanswered and make it harder to tell which content is earning useful visibility.

Correction: Group queries by intent and create or improve pages only where the practice has a legitimate service, enough distinct information, and appropriate clinical review. Examples can include procedure comparisons, recovery questions, cost context, surgeon qualifications, and post-procedure information such as what a patient may ask about during week 2. Avoid publishing diagnosis or personalized treatment advice in order to capture a keyword.

Owner: SEO or content strategist with surgeon review for clinical accuracy and practice-specific claims.

Verification: After recrawling, check whether each target query maps to the intended page, whether pages compete unnecessarily with one another, and whether qualified consultation actions are attributable. Keyword repetition is not a substitute for intent fit, and ranking movement should not be interpreted as proof that a page caused a patient decision.

Mistake #4: Creating Location Pages for Markets That Are Not Genuine Clinic Locations

Observable evidence: Inventory every location page and compare it with operational records. Flag pages that differ mainly by city name, point to the same clinic, repeat the same copy, or imply a local presence that the practice does not actually have.

Consequence: Near-duplicate geographic pages can dilute the usefulness of the site, confuse prospective patients, and create advertising or local-information risk when the page overstates where the surgeon practices. The source described algorithmic quality concerns, but no supporting source URL here proves that duplicate city pages automatically suppress the entire domain.

Correction: Keep a dedicated location page only for a genuine location with useful location-specific information, such as accurate access details, services actually available there, surgeon or staff information, hours, consultation logistics, and other facts that differ meaningfully. For service areas without a clinic, use accurate broader service information instead of manufacturing local pages.

Map embeds, local schema, internal links, and citations can be useful when they reflect real information, but none should be presented as a guaranteed or official ranking factor. Structured data must match visible page facts, and an embedded map should be included for user value rather than as a ranking tactic.

Owner: Practice operations owner with SEO and legal or advertising review when location claims could affect regulated marketing.

Verification: Confirm each page against the practice's actual locations, compare name, address, phone, and hours across the website and relevant profiles, remove unsupported market claims, and rerun the crawl to ensure consolidated or redirected pages resolve correctly.

Mistake #5: Before-and-After Galleries With Weak Image Context or Patient-Image Governance

Observable evidence: Audit gallery file names, alt text, captions, surrounding context, file sizes, consent records, and the destinations where each image is published. A filename such as 'IMG_4023.jpg' is difficult for a team to manage compared with a descriptive internal naming convention, but filenames alone do not determine search performance.

Consequence: Poor image context can reduce accessibility and make galleries harder for users and systems to interpret. Oversized files can slow mobile experiences. More importantly, patient-image use can create privacy, consent, advertising, and reputational risk if the practice cannot document why and where an identifiable image may be published.

Correction: Use accurate descriptive text that reflects what is visibly relevant without making outcome guarantees. Review accessibility against the source's WCAG 2.1 AA reference with the appropriate accessibility owner, compress images without compromising their clinical or visual purpose, and maintain a documented authorization workflow before publication.

The source previously cited the HIPAA Privacy Rule (45 CFR 164.502) and FTC expectations for patient images and testimonials. Because this JSON contains no supporting regulatory source URLs, treat those references as requiring current legal and regulatory reconciliation rather than as verified legal advice. Do not infer that every image, disclosure, or testimonial has the same rule set in every jurisdiction.

Owner: Privacy or compliance lead with marketing, web, and the responsible surgeon or clinical reviewer.

Verification: Reconcile each published image with the authorization record and intended channels, test keyboard and screen-reader context where relevant, inspect mobile performance, and confirm that any outcome language is reviewed and not presented as a guaranteed or typical result without appropriate substantiation.

Mistake #6: Technical Defects That Obscure Discovery, Measurement, or User Access

Observable evidence: Crawl the site, inspect indexing in Search Console, review Core Web Vitals and mobile usability, validate structured data against visible page facts, and compare current URLs with migration or redesign records.

Consequence: Broken redirects, error pages, duplicated metadata, invalid markup, or slow templates can make pages harder to discover, understand, measure, or use. Do not treat any single Core Web Vitals metric or schema implementation as a guaranteed ranking lever.

Correction: Restore intended destinations with appropriate 301 redirects where a relevant replacement exists, resolve legacy URLs that return 404 errors when they should lead somewhere useful, repair crawl blocks, reduce avoidable page-weight problems, and remove or correct structured data that conflicts with the page.

Owner: Technical SEO or web developer, with analytics ownership for measurement changes and privacy review where tracking is involved.

Verification: Rerun the same crawl and Search Console checks used to find the defect, confirm redirects and status codes manually, validate markup without assuming rich-result eligibility, and compare pre-change and post-change traffic cautiously. Frequently Asked Questions

How can I separate an SEO defect from normal variation in a plastic surgery market?

Start with evidence you can reproduce: crawl and indexing status, Google Business Profile accuracy, query-to-page mapping, local visibility for comparable searches, and qualified inquiry attribution.

Competitor comparisons can help reveal a gap, but similar tenure or case volume does not prove that ranking differences are caused by SEO alone. A technical audit plus query and content-gap review should identify the first point where your site diverges from the evidence you expect.

Can Google Business Profile problems affect more than local visibility?

Google Business Profile primarily affects how the practice is represented in local search surfaces, while organic blue-link rankings use broader systems. Conflicting business information across the profile and website can still create operational and user-trust problems, so fix inaccurate name, address, phone, category, hours, and destination links.

Do not assume that a profile correction directly improves organic rankings or that review activity is a guaranteed ranking lever.

What should I check first after a sudden organic traffic drop?

Use the source's three diagnostic categories as a starting checklist rather than a conclusion: search-system changes, a migration or redesign that altered URLs or indexing, and a manual action or other Search Console issue.

Check Search Console first, then compare the timing of the drop with deployments, redirects, crawl data, and publicly documented search updates. A date correlation can guide investigation, but it does not by itself prove the cause.

How should I interpret recovery timing after SEO mistakes are corrected?

The source previously described four to eight weeks for some technical fixes and three to six months for deeper content recovery. Those are historical planning ranges, not guarantees. Recrawl timing, the severity of the defect, competition, existing site quality, and the scope of the correction can all change the pace.

Verify recovery by stage: first confirm the fix is live and crawlable, then watch relevant visibility, then qualified inquiry attribution.

Should an old procedure page with little traffic be removed?

Not before checking whether the page still has useful content, inbound links, internal-link value, or a relevant replacement. If a replacement exists, a 301 redirect may preserve a clean user path and help search systems understand the move.

If there is no relevant destination, do not redirect merely to keep a status code. Review backlinks, indexation, and page purpose before deciding whether to update, consolidate, redirect, or remove it.

How can a practice keep the same SEO mistakes from returning?

Build recurring ownership around content accuracy, technical health, local-profile data, patient-image governance, and measurement. The source recommended quarterly content and technical review, monthly Search Console checks, monthly profile review, and procedure-page comparisons twice per year.

Treat those cadences as an operating example, not a ranking formula. The stronger control is that every recurring check has an owner, evidence standard, corrective action, and documented verification.
